abstract | ABSTRACT A coating process in which an article to be coated is immersed as an anode in a dispersion of a film-forming material stabilised by non-ionic stabilization and an electric current is passed between the anode and another electrode immersed in the dispersion. The dispersion is destabilised in the region of and is deposited on the anode by interaction between a moiety providing the non-ionic stabilisation (e.g. polyethylene glycol) and a further interactive moiety (e.g. carboxyl groups present as polymethacrylic acid) present in the dispersion. |
